What is Iron Ferric Pyrophosphate?

Iron ferric pyrophosphate (chemical formula: Fe2(P2O7)3) is a stable and insoluble iron compound that plays a crucial role in numerous applications, particularly in the fields of nutrition, pharmaceuticals, and environmental science. It is recognized for its iron content, making it a valuable source of this essential mineral.

Nutritional Supplementation

One of the primary uses of iron ferric pyrophosphate is in nutritional supplements, particularly for fortifying foods. Iron is vital for human health, as it is a key component of hemoglobin, which carries oxygen in the blood. Iron deficiency can lead to anemia and various health issues.

1. Food Fortification

Iron ferric pyrophosphate is often used to fortify cereals, flour, and other food products. Its insoluble nature ensures that it does not alter the taste or appearance of the food, making it an ideal choice for enhancing the iron content of staple foods. This is particularly important in regions where iron deficiency is prevalent.

2. Dietary Supplements

Beyond food fortification, iron ferric pyrophosphate is also incorporated into dietary supplements. These supplements are designed to improve iron intake among individuals at risk of deficiency, such as pregnant women, vegetarians, and those with certain health conditions.

Pharmaceutical Applications

In the pharmaceutical industry, iron ferric pyrophosphate is utilized in various formulations due to its bioavailability and safety profile.

1. Injectable Iron Preparations

Iron ferric pyrophosphate is often used in injectable iron formulations for patients with severe iron deficiency anemia, especially when oral iron supplements are ineffective or poorly tolerated. Its use in injectable form allows for rapid replenishment of iron stores in the body.

2. Controlled Release Systems

The compound is also being researched for its potential in controlled release systems, wherein iron is released gradually in the body, thereby enhancing absorption and reducing the risk of gastrointestinal side effects.

Environmental Applications

Another interesting aspect of iron ferric pyrophosphate is its environmental applications.

1. Water Treatment

Iron ferric pyrophosphate can be used in water treatment processes to remove contaminants. Its ability to bind with various pollutants makes it useful in treating wastewater and purifying drinking water, contributing to environmental sustainability.

2. Soil Amendment

In agriculture, iron ferric pyrophosphate can serve as a soil amendment, improving soil fertility and promoting plant growth. Its slow-release properties ensure that iron is made available to plants over an extended period, enhancing their nutritional uptake.
